I went with the E120, as I was going to roll with Navionics Platinium, as well as use the VGA and camera inputs for a solid state computer, and a FLIR camera at some time. Seeing as FLIR is darn near 10 grand, it's going to have to wait unless there is a cheaper version available.

The whole idea behind the FLIR is to actually see the ships in the fog, as opposed to guessing if they are going to miss you by an obscure radar blip. Once they (the ships) get within about half a mile, it's really hard to determine if they are going by you are not. Where I fish for Hali's, if I am on a dynamite drift, and I can be assured of being safe on the drift, it makes life a lot easier then trying to get three or four hali rods up in a flash, run away, and see if the darn thing is going by or not.
